site stats

React native best practices

Webapi/. This folder contains logic related to external API communications, it includes: constants.js - where all required static values are stored. helper.js - for storing reusable … WebApr 13, 2024 · Unit tests are a universal best practice in software development. React-Native user interface code is no exception, with Jest being the most common testing framework. React’s Animated View ...

7 Best Practices for React Native Applications - Medium

WebApr 6, 2024 · React internationalization with i18n. Photo by Sigmund on Unsplash. Internationalization (i18n) is a crucial aspect of developing applications that need to be accessed by users who speak different languages. React.js provides a built-in i18n library, called react-intl, that makes it easy to internationalize your React application. WebThe best practice is to move such requests outside (E.g. Redux actions with a middleware like redux-thunk) the components. It's better to check if the access token is expired (by decoding the token) before sending the API request and retrieve the new access token. This will reduce the amount of requests to server. can i change my race https://karenmcdougall.com

25 React Native Best Practices You Should Know - eSparkBiz

WebOct 11, 2024 · Use fast loading image formats in React Native Schedule animations with InteractionManager and LayoutAnimation Use native driver with the Animated API Remove unnecessary libraries Use Hermes Use Reselect with Redux Monitor memory usage in React Native Navigation in React Native How does React Native work? WebApr 20, 2024 · We discussed the benefits of using React Native libraries to leverage native features in your mobile app, recommended specific tools to help you with styling, debugging, data fetching and more, and outlined some tips and best practices to help you get the most out of these React Native libraries. WebMar 9, 2024 · FlatList is a powerful React Native component that allows developers to render large sets of data in an efficient and performant way. However, it can also be challenging to use correctly. In this article, we’ll explore best practices for using FlatList in your React Native app and provide you with helpful examples along the way. fitness williamstown

7 Best Practices for React Native Applications - Medium

Category:GitHub - chnirt/reactnative-best-practice: React Native (ReactJS ...

Tags:React native best practices

React native best practices

GitHub - chnirt/reactnative-best-practice: React Native (ReactJS ...

WebReact Native is a framework desig... Hello everyone, I am Rupal Chakraborty from Innofied and today I am here to discuss the top 10 react native best practices. WebFeb 28, 2024 · 5. Use Platform Specific Styles. React Native offers a built-in API to write platform-specific code, without the Platform API you will end up having a lot of different styles for different platforms (Android & iOS), to organize these styles you can use the Platform module for Stylesheets.You can use the Platform.OS to automatically detect the …

React native best practices

Did you know?

WebMar 9, 2024 · FlatList is a powerful React Native component that allows developers to render large sets of data in an efficient and performant way. However, it can also be … WebFeb 16, 2024 · One of the standard best practices of React Native application is managing your static image resources the right way. In simple words, we can say that your React Native applications need to be capable of handling static image resources as there are more chances of utilizing a lot of time to work with static files.

WebMar 17, 2024 · In this guide, you will learn about best practices for storing sensitive information, authentication, network security, and tools that will help you secure your app. … WebMar 13, 2024 · Divide your React components into two directories - components and containers. You can name them differently as per your choice. containers are directories …

WebAug 25, 2024 · 8 Best Practices for Your React Native App by Engineering@ZenOfAI ZenOf.AI Medium 500 Apologies, but something went wrong on our end. Refresh the … WebDec 25, 2024 · To aid in preventing these scenarios from occurring, I’ve crafted a list of 7 best practices for optimizing API calls with React Native – let’s get rolling! #1: Use a Dedicated HTTP Client Library. #2: Cache Data When Possible. #3: Use Pagination for Large Data Sets. #4: Use a Throttling or Debouncing Mechanism.

WebCollaborate with cross-functional teams to design, develop, and maintain responsive web applications using React and Redux Develop and maintain reusable React components and libraries to support the needs of multiple projects Write efficient and scalable code using best practices, including code review and unit testing

WebApr 28, 2024 · When working with React Native and iOS, it’s typical to use Xcode as build tool. Building apps that run on iOS requires at least some Xcode knowledge. In this tutorial, we’ll walk you through some best practices to help you get started using Xcode and offer some tips that will change the way you develop iOS apps with React Native. fitness williamsburg vaWebDec 12, 2024 · One of React best practices that helps to organize all your React components is the use of tools like Bit. These tools help to maintain and reuse code. Beyond that, it … fitness williamsport paWebFeb 3, 2024 · Learn The Building Blocks of React. Learn How to Build Clean, Performant and Maintainable React Components. Tips to Help You Write Better React Code – The … fitness windsor missouriWebMar 17, 2024 · The developers must always keep in mind to operate with the latest version of React Native whenever using Hermes. Put simply, with Hermes, one can easily decrease the APK download size, along with memory footprint, memory consumption, and time to interact in terms of the application. 2. Fine-tuning the Image Size. can i change my ram in pcWebDec 2, 2024 · The best way to learn React native is to practice React native by building as many projects as possible. There are three factors you should consider when picking the right React native project: your skill level, goals, and interest. You want to have a good idea of your skill level and choose React native practice projects that are not too easy ... fitness williamsburgWebDec 31, 2024 · React Native though being a new platform has garnered a lot of attention. It is estimated that nearly 1/10th of apps that are available on the app store are built using RN. … fitness wilmington deWebYou can put you all screen-based components inside here (Eg - SplashScreen, HomeScreen). navigation/ You project base navigation goes here. You can create stack navigator and export it to your application. styles/ If you have global styles defined in your project you can put it over here like colors, font styles like things. utilites/ can i change my realtor agent